Unsure when to prune? Here's a helpful gardening idea: prune spring-flowering shrubs, for example lilacs, promptly following the blooms fade. They established their flower buds in autumn on previous calendar year's development. For those who prune them in fall or winter, you take away upcoming spring's flower buds.
